Bill History

2024 REGULAR SESSION

Jan 4
Prefiled for introduction.
Jan 8
First reading, referred to Health Care & Wellness. (View Original Bill)
Jan 10
Public hearing in the House Committee on Health Care & Wellness at 1:30 PM. (Committee Materials)
Jan 17
Executive session scheduled, but no action was taken in the House Committee on Health Care & Wellness at 1:30 PM. (Committee Materials)
Jan 30
Executive action taken in the House Committee on Health Care & Wellness at 1:30 PM. (Committee Materials)
HCW - Majority; 1st substitute bill be substituted, do pass. (View 1st Substitute) (Majority Report)
Jan 31
Referred to Appropriations.
Feb 3
Public hearing in the House Committee on Appropriations at 9:00 AM. (Committee Materials)
Feb 5
Executive action taken in the House Committee on Appropriations at 10:30 AM. (Committee Materials)
APP - Majority; 2nd substitute bill be substituted, do pass. (View 2nd Substitute) (Majority Report)
Referred to Rules 2 Review.
Feb 9
Rules Committee relieved of further consideration. Placed on second reading.
Feb 12
2nd substitute bill substituted (APP 24). (View 2nd Substitute)
Floor amendment(s) adopted.
Rules suspended. Placed on Third Reading.
Third reading, passed; yeas, 97; nays, 0; absent, 0; excused, 1. (View 1st Engrossed) (View Roll Calls)

IN THE SENATE

Feb 14
First reading, referred to Health & Long Term Care.
Feb 16
Public hearing in the Senate Committee on Health & Long Term Care at 8:00 AM. (Committee Materials)
Feb 20
Executive action taken in the Senate Committee on Health & Long Term Care at 8:00 AM. (Committee Materials)
HLTC - Majority; do pass with amendment(s). (Majority Report)
And refer to Ways & Means.
Feb 21
Referred to Ways & Means.
Mar 7
By resolution, returned to House Rules Committee for third reading.
